I agree that the terminating statement analysis proposed here is complying to the Go specification and seems correct in its implementation.

However I'm not sure that it is the best response (or at least not sufficient) to the class of errors we want to address here: missing or wrong return statements.

We should have instead a check of each return statement to be compliant with the function signature (including the special case of pre-declared returned values allowing an empty return), and the detection of a missing return at the end of function body.

This check will still be necessary, even if we implement termination analysis.

If we have this check, then termination analysis becomes much less useful, except to catch the possibility of skipping a return if all the previous branches have one, which is just an optimisation.

To me the gain of termination analysis in this context is marginal. I don't know if it is justified in the context of an interpreter. Or maybe I missed something ?

The idea of this was to catch bad code like

func foo(b bool) int {
   if b {
     return 1
  }
}

Which corrupts the VM stack.
Whether the return statement returns the correct type or not is up to the type checker.
The only job of the termination analysis is to make sure there is a return statement where one is required.
This is essentially what you said the detection of a missing return at the end of function body.
The other stuff that you referred to is already implemented in the type checking code.
